iDRAC7 feature comparison
iDRAC7 Enterprise is available for the PowerEdge M520, and Dell also offers an option of iDRAC7
Express for Blades. A detailed feature comparison for iDRAC7 Enterprise and iDRAC7 Express for
Blades is shown in Table 20.

If iDRAC7 Express for Blades or iDRAC7
Enterprise is ordered during initial point of
sale, license key is installed. If Basic
Management is ordered during initial point of
sale, customer must request a license key
through the Dell Licensing Portal.
For most server models, embedded server
management and electronic licensing
enables feature enhancements that do not
require installation of additional hardware or
system downtime.
